引言Java作为一种广泛应用于企业级应用、移动应用和Web开发的编程语言,其强大的跨平台特性和丰富的生态系统使其成为开发者们的首选。Java模拟器作为Java开发的重要组成部分,提供了在非Java原生...
Java作为一种广泛应用于企业级应用、移动应用和Web开发的编程语言,其强大的跨平台特性和丰富的生态系统使其成为开发者们的首选。Java模拟器作为Java开发的重要组成部分,提供了在非Java原生环境下的Java代码执行能力。本文将深入探讨Java模拟器的工作原理、使用方法以及如何通过模拟器轻松掌握虚拟环境操作。
Java模拟器,又称为Java虚拟机(Java Virtual Machine,JVM),是Java运行时环境的核心组件。它提供了一个可以执行Java字节码的虚拟环境,使得Java程序能够在不同的操作系统和硬件平台上运行。
Java虚拟机通过以下步骤执行Java程序:
根据用途,Java虚拟机主要分为以下几种:
要使用Java模拟器,首先需要安装Java开发工具包(JDK)。可以从Oracle官网或开源社区获取JDK的安装包。
在安装JDK后,需要配置环境变量,以便在任何命令行窗口中都能访问Java命令。
使用文本编辑器编写Java程序,并保存为.java文件。
使用javac命令编译Java程序。
javac YourProgram.java使用java命令运行编译后的程序。
java YourProgramIDE提供了丰富的功能,如代码提示、自动格式化、调试等,可以大大提高开发效率。
对于需要使用不同JVM版本的项目,可以使用工具如jenv或sdkman来管理多个JVM版本。
Maven和Gradle是流行的项目构建工具,可以自动化项目依赖管理和构建过程。
Java模拟器是Java开发者不可或缺的工具之一。通过掌握Java模拟器的使用方法,开发者可以轻松地创建、编译和运行Java程序,从而在虚拟环境中进行编程实践。通过本文的介绍,相信读者已经对Java模拟器有了更深入的了解,并能够将其应用于实际开发中。